Today, during our plenary at the Senate, we debated various bills, including two on the amendments of the acts of the North West Development Commission (NWDC) and the South East Development Commission (SEDC), to enable us to correct omissions noticed in the laws.
I supported the amendments sought because, as human beings, we can never be perfect all the time; it’s only Almighty God who does everything perfectly. These were the mere omissions that we discovered after the bills were passed.
Unanimously, other senators who contributed to the debate, including Senator Abdulrahman Kawu Sumaila, threw their weight behind the amendments. While commending President Bola Ahmed Tinubu for approving the bill to establish the NWDC, Kawu Sumaila said irrespective of all differences, the commission means a lot “to all of us in the North West geopolitical zone”.
Similarly, while contributing to the debate on a bill for the establishment of the South-South Development Commission (SSDC), I drew the attention of my colleagues to the need to amend Niger Delta Development Commission (NDDC) to accommodate Bauchi, Gombe, Lagos and Ogun states that are now oil-producing.
I supported the bill for establishing the South-South Development Commission because what is good for the goose is also good for the gander. As we all know, NDDC was created to mitigate the problems oil-producing areas face, such as environmental degradation due to oil exploration in these areas.
So, NDDC was primarily created to take care of these environmental challenges and is not restricted to Niger Delta, as we have states in the South East and South West as beneficiaries.
With the creation of development commissions for other zones, like mine, North West, there is nothing wrong, if a similar commission is created in the South-South. After that, when the commission has been established, then we have to look at the NDDC Act again to change the name to Oil Producing Areas Commission so that it will include states like Gombe, Bauchi, Lagos, Kogi, Ogun that are now producing oil.
